Just returned from my stay at the Aruba Renaissance Resort. Thought I would send this along.

When I arrived at the Renaissance I discovered there were two separate buildings in two separate locations. One the Marina Hotel and the other the Ocean Suites. I was placed at the Marina Hotel.

I bid for Resort level on Priceline.

The Ocean Suites is a Resort level accommodation, the Marina Hotel is not. I would rate the Marina at 3.5 or 4.0. When I protested I was told that the two units were all part of the Renaissance Aruba Resort. Even though I had to take a provided shuttle to get to the Ocean Suites portion. It was available to me. If I wanted to stay at the Ocean Suites there would be an additional charge.

So, just a word of caution. If you bid for a Resort level of accommodation on Aruba, you could get a lesser level.

I called Priceline, and asked how they could list two separate buildings at two separate locations as one level of accommodation? Customer service was no help.

We still had a nice time. But may use Hotwire next time.
